[17/23] powerpc: Enable compile-time check for syscall handlers

The table of syscall handlers and registered compatibility syscall
handlers has in past been produced using assembly, with function
references resolved at link time. This moves link-time errors to
compile-time, by rewriting systbl.S in C, and including the
linux/syscalls.h, linux/compat.h and asm/syscalls.h headers for
prototypes.

V1 -> V2: New patch.
V4 -> V5: For this patch only, represent handler function pointers as
unsigned long. Remove reference to syscall wrappers. Use asm/syscalls.h
which implies asm/syscall.h

Patch

diff --git a/arch/powerpc/kernel/systbl.S b/arch/powerpc/kernel/systbl.c
similarity index 61%
rename from arch/powerpc/kernel/systbl.S
rename to arch/powerpc/kernel/systbl.c
index 6c1db3b6de2d..ce52bd2ec292 100644
--- a/arch/powerpc/kernel/systbl.S
+++ b/arch/powerpc/kernel/systbl.c
@@ -10,32 +10,26 @@ 
  * PPC64 updates by Dave Engebretsen (engebret@us.ibm.com) 
  */
 
-#include <asm/ppc_asm.h>
+#include <linux/syscalls.h>
+#include <linux/compat.h>
+#include <asm/unistd.h>
+#include <asm/syscalls.h>
 
-.section .rodata,"a"
+#define __SYSCALL_WITH_COMPAT(nr, entry, compat) __SYSCALL(nr, entry)
+#define __SYSCALL(nr, entry) [nr] = (unsigned long) &entry,
 
-#ifdef CONFIG_PPC64
-	.p2align	3
-#define __SYSCALL(nr, entry)	.8byte entry
-#else
-	.p2align	2
-#define __SYSCALL(nr, entry)	.long entry
-#endif
-
-#define __SYSCALL_WITH_COMPAT(nr, native, compat)	__SYSCALL(nr, native)
-.globl sys_call_table
-sys_call_table:
+const unsigned long sys_call_table[] = {
 #ifdef CONFIG_PPC64
 #include <asm/syscall_table_64.h>
 #else
 #include <asm/syscall_table_32.h>
 #endif
+};
 
 #ifdef CONFIG_COMPAT
 #undef __SYSCALL_WITH_COMPAT
 #define __SYSCALL_WITH_COMPAT(nr, native, compat)	__SYSCALL(nr, compat)
-.globl compat_sys_call_table
-compat_sys_call_table:
-#define compat_sys_sigsuspend	sys_sigsuspend
+const unsigned long compat_sys_call_table[] = {
 #include <asm/syscall_table_32.h>
-#endif
+};
+#endif /* CONFIG_COMPAT */
